WebSep 20, 2024 · There are 3 forms of energy during a bungee jump, kinetic (KE = 0.5mv^2), gravitational potential (GPE = mgh) and elastic potential (EPE = 0.5kx^2). Energy is conserved throughout, and it’s assumed none is lost as heat due to air resistance. Why does a bungee jumper jump up and down? What forces acts on a jumper? Webphysics principles, such as the conservation of energy and Hooke’s law for springs. A safe bungee jump occurs when no one is injured. An exhilarating bungee jump is one in which no one is injured, the free fall lasts as long a time as possible, and the bungee jumper comes as close to the ground as possible without touching it. WebJan 21, 2024 · In general bungee jumping is very safe but certain conditions can make it potentially dangerous. These conditions include high blood pressure, a heart condition, dizziness, epilepsy, and injuries to the neck, back, spinal column, or legs.
